So what if they knew about her ‘dark past’? She was now, in name and in fact, a lady of the Harvest family. Their fates were intertwined; her honor was their honor, her disgrace was their disgrace. No matter how reluctant they were, they would have to cover for her and clean up her messes.
“What are you doing, skulking around like that?”
A sharp voice behind her made Ann jump and spin around. Fidelia stepped to where Ann had been standing and could clearly hear the conversation between her parents and grandmother through the slightly ajar door.
Fidelia pointed an accusing finger. “How dare you eavesdrop on my grandmother and my parents?”
Ann immediately denied it. “Fidelia, you should be careful with your words. I just got here. I was about to go in and talk to Grandma when you showed up.”
“You’re lying!” Fidelia shot back. “I saw you from down the hall, sneaking around and listening at the door. And you still dare to deny it!”
Ann retorted with righteous indignation, “Fidelia, I’m your older sister now. How can you speak to your sister with such a nasty tone?”
Fidelia pointed at Ann with disgust. “Everyone says you’re a bad woman. You are not my sister!”
A flicker of malice crossed Ann’s eyes. Glancing down the empty corridor, she grabbed Fidelia’s wrist and twisted it sharply.
Fidelia cried out in pain. “You wicked woman, let go of me!”
Ann lowered her voice to a menacing hiss. “Fidelia, you’d better learn to be polite to your older sister. Otherwise, you’re going to suffer.”
Fidelia, terrified by the look in Ann’s eyes, had tears welling up from the pain. Just as Ann heard movement from inside the room, she took Fidelia’s hand, slapped herself hard across the face with it, then let go and stumbled back, clutching her cheek.
Fidelia was young and had never encountered such a scheme. She could only point at Ann and shout, “You horrible woman!”
Just then, the matriarch and her son and daughter-in-law emerged from the room to witness the scene. Ann, face in her hands, scurried to the matriarch’s side and began to sob pitifully.
